Stratified profiling of azoospermia: Differentiating histological subtypes with seminal plasma metabolic signatures

  • Non-obstructive azoospermia (NOA), characterized by impaired spermatogenesis and the complete absence of sperm in the ejaculate, represents one of the most severe forms of male infertility. Current diagnostic strategies rely on invasive procedures such as testicular sperm extraction, underscoring the urgent need for reliable, non-invasive alternatives. In the present study, we performed untargeted metabolomic profiling of human seminal plasma to identify biomarker panels capable of stratifying azoospermia subtypes through a stepwise approach. We identified distinct metabolite biomarker panels comparing NOA vs. obstructive azoospermia (OA), Sertoli cell-only syndrome vs. other NOA subtypes, and hypospermatogenesis vs. maturation arrest. Additionally, cross-species comparative analysis with high-resolution metabolomic data from purified mouse testicular cell populations implicated these biomarkers in specific germ cell stages and metabolic transitions during spermatogenesis. These findings establish a molecular framework for the non-invasive classification of azoospermia subtypes and provide novel insights into the metabolic disruptions underlying male infertility.
